In January, Greenfield generally has very low temperatures and moderate snow/rainfall. January is a winter month.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around 1°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ate -10°C. It's often the coldest month of the year, a perfect time to cozy up indoors. Make sure to bring along suitable winter clothing.
Greenfield in January usually receives moderate snow/rainfall, averaging around 87 mm for the month. When we look at the climate data from the last 30 years, we can expect around 13 days of snow/rain.
The city usually sees around 170 hours of sunlight, indicating a moderately sunny period.
If you're looking for dry conditions and comfortable temperatures, January may not be the ideal month to visit Greenfield. May, June, July, August and September typically offer the best circumstances. While January, February, March, November and December tend to showcase less optimal conditions.
